A collective team effort from the Karnali Yaks saw them defend a modest total of 128/8. Their innings began on a shaky note, with the Lumbini Lions' bowlers asserting dominance early on. Bikash Aagri impressed with figures of 3/14, while Tilak Bhandari provided solid support, taking 2/24.
The highest run-scorer for the Sompal Kami-led side was William Bosisto, who played a crucial knock of 44 off 30 balls.
Rohit Paudel-led Lumbini Lions, already out of the playoff race with just one win in six matches, faltered in their chase as the Yaks' bowlers delivered a high-quality performance.
The captain fell early for just 8 off 10 balls, while Tom Moores top-scored for the Lions with a steady 36 off 35 balls.
Karnali's bowling attack, led by Zeeshan Maqsood's figures of 2/12, was clinical. Sompal Kami, Nandan Yadav, Bipin Sharma, and William Bosisto all contributed with a wicket each restricting the Lumbini Lions for just 123 runs with 7 down in 20 overs, winning the match 5 runs.
Karnali Yaks are in contention for a play-off spot with a terrific run of form. They lost their first two matches but then bounced back and are now on a winning run of four matches.
